(7分)该图是我国东部某地等高线地形图,某校高中学生夏令营在图示区域进行了野外天文、地质、植被、聚落等综合考察活动。读图回答下列问题。

(1)同学们沿图中的登山线路行进,观察到沿途植被垂直变化不大,你认为主要原因是什么?(2分)

(2)同学们把夜晚宿营地点选在图中A处,从图中提供的信息简述理由。(2分)

(3)图示地区拟建一火情瞭望台,最佳位置应在________         处。(1分)

(4)若考察小组在D处突遇泥石流,①②③④四条逃生线路中最佳的是________。突临的一场暴雨,使位于B处的营员小明迷了路。请你给他一个独自走出深山密林的最佳办法。(2分)

答案

(1)沿线相对高度不够大,水热状况垂直分布不显著。(2分) 

(2)位于鞍部,地势相对平坦开阔。 (2分)

(3)山顶 (1分)           (4)  ②      顺河谷的溪水流向走。(2分)

(1)本题考查垂直地带性变化规律。变化差异与海拔高度有关。(2)宿营地点区位从地形、河流、地质安全等方面分析。(3)火情瞭望台位于海拔高,四周没有遮挡的位置。(4)泥石流逃生路径是垂直等高线向高处逃生。顺河流最终走出密林。

Car companies are developing vehicles that will plug into electric sockets,just like many laptops,digital cameras,cell phones and Mp4 do.Called“plug-in vehicles”,these cars will get most of their power from electricity. Their drivers won't have to stop at gas stations as often as usual.

The technology is more than just cool. In our car-filled world,plug-in vehicles could reduce the amount of gas we use,which keeps rising in cost now and then. Besides,driving around in these vehicles may even help the environment.Gas-burning cars produce a lot of greenhouse gas,which causes globe warming.

The first company-produced plug-in vehicles could hit the roads by 2010. But engineers still have a lot of work to do to make the technology practical and inexpensive.

Batteries(电池) are the biggest challenge. In the plug-in-vehicle world,Li-ion(锂离子)batteries are getting the most attention.These batteries can store a large amount of energy in a small package,and they last a longer time between charges.Li-ion batteries can fit laptops,cell phones,heart instruments and other similar pocket ones.

But because cars are so big and heavy, it would still require a suitcase-sized Li-ion batteries to power about 12km of driving.What's more,the batteries are much expensive.

“A car filled with batteries could go a long distance,”says Ted Bohn, an electrical engineer in Chicago.“But it couldn't pull any people.and it would cost $100,000.”

So researchers need to work out how to make batteries smaller and cheaper,among other questions.

“The answers don't exist yet,”Bohn says,“As a kid,I thought someone someplace knows the answer to everything.All of these questions haven't been decided.That's what engineering is about-making a guess,running tests and getting fine results.”
